Seventy-eight patients with advanced cancer received an adequate therapeutic trial with aniline mustard (NSC 18429). Significant anticancer activity with clinical benefit was demonstrated in five patients with cancer of the prostate and one patient with
renal cancer
.
beta-glucuronidase
levels in aspirate and imprint preparations of tumor cells were assessed by a timed cytochemical technique. A partial correlation appeared to exist between very intense glucuronidase staining and tumor regression in prostate and kidney lesions; however, these high levels were observed only rarely. Sequential observations in two patients demonstrated loss of enzymatic activity concomitant with development of clinical relapse.

Renal tissue sections from 178 patients, whose kidneys were either normal or altered by various conditions such as hydronephrosis, interstitial nephropathies, chronic graft rejection,
renal cancer
etc., were investigated by computer-assisted histophotometry. We used enzyme histochemical and immunologic methods to measure kidneys suffering from various urological diseases quantitatively. Through this procedure, we were able to obtain information that allowed us to determine the degree of alteration in the metabolic state of tubular epithelial cells. The tissue activities of the following enzymes of the proximal tubule were investigated: alanine aminopeptidase (AAP), alkaline phosphatase (AP) and maltase (Ma) as membrane-bound markers, and
beta-glucuronidase
(beta-Gl) as a lysosomal marker. In addition, AAP and gamma-glutamyltranspeptidase (GGTP) were measured by immunofluorescent microscopy after having added specific anti-enzyme antibodies to the tissue sections. Compared to normal kidneys, quantitative enzyme histograms of diseased kidneys revealed a significant decrease in marker protein concentration of the tubule. The decline in tissue enzyme activities of AP, AAP, Ma and beta-Gl was accompanied by a significant decrease of enzyme concentrations as measured by the immuno histological method. This was especially true in cases with
kidney cancer
and in kidney tissues adjacent to infiltration adenocarcinoma. Morphological analyses of alterations were generally improved by enzymatic and/or immunologic histophotometry.
